    Watch Show 403 and get excited!!!

    In anticipation of Ricky's lessons I watched his Kool Kaleidoscope show 403 from way back when.
    I thought I had seen most all of the quilt shows but I don't remember this one. It looks like it is going to
    be a really fun class. HelenW

      Terri, I was wondering how small you would have to go to use fat quarters for this project. On the Show 403 Ricky based his
      wedges on a square that was 18 inches. That uses the width of the fabric to get 6 copies of a template. If you made your
      square 9 inches, that would be half. Half of the width of a fabric on a bolt is a fat quarter. To get the 2 identical strip sets you
      would cut your fat quarters in half lengthwise and lay one on top of the other then cut the strips. I was thinking I might play around with some paper templates to see if it was even possible. Just curious. HelenW

        HelenW, I'm interested in what you find out. I watched Show 403 and I am interested in making a smaller version. The 18" square Pattern makes a 36" square quilt (before border) so 9" pattern should make 18" square quilt. I think that is what I will try to make. Sandy

          Sandy, I drew up a 9 inch template. Divided it the same way Ricky did on the show. Cut the pieces apart. Number 3 seemed to be
          the biggest so I made 6 of them and laid it on the paper representing a fat quarter. It looks like it would have enough room and making sure you had at least 1/2 inch between pieces for the seam allowances. The strip set could be about 5 or 6 inches wide.
          There might be some aspects I am not thinking of, since I have not done this process before. HelenW

              Sandy, A couple things to think about. I made up a full size template for 18 inch finished size in EQ8. The "nose" section is really quite small. You could draw your lines farther out to make it longer, but since the width is 30 degrees, it will not get any wider. That means
              a bunch of seams all coming together with that little template piece. I have done enough Judy Neimeyers to know it can get real
              frustrating. Maybe find a center fabric that can do some of the work for you. I had a scrap of this multicolor fabric in lines that would work if I had enough. The other thing I was thinking was to sew 1/4 inch seams then trim them down to 1/8 inch for the strip sets.
              Another thing I was thinking was to put steam a seam on an 1/2 inch wide strip the length of a fat quarter and and fuse it to another
              strip and edge stitch. That would eliminate the seam. Just thinking right now. HelenW
